drop (someone or something) like a hot brick

To abandon someone or something suddenly and completely, sometimes to avoid potential problems. I haven't seen Cynthia in weeks because she dropped me like a hot brick once she started hanging out with the cool kids. We dropped our renovation plans like a hot brick after finding out how much the job would cost.
